Deep Foundation Installation in Fort Worth, TX
Deep foundation installation services involve the process of securely anchoring structures into the ground to provide stability and support for various types of construction projects. This service is commonly used for new home foundations, additions, retaining walls, and other structures that require a solid base to withstand soil conditions and load demands. Property owners often seek this service when building on challenging soil types, preparing for large-scale renovations, or ensuring the long-term stability of their property.
Before requesting deep foundation installation, property owners typically want to understand the types of foundations suitable for their project, the soil conditions at the site, and the overall impact on existing structures. It is also important to consider the scope of work, including whether the installation involves piles, drilled shafts, or other methods, and how the process may affect nearby landscaping or utilities. Gathering this information can help ensure the foundation is designed and installed to meet the specific needs of the property.

Common Deep Foundation Installation Jobs
Driven Piles - used to support heavy structures like new home additions and commercial buildings.
drilled shafts - installed for stable foundation support in challenging soil conditions.
micropiles - ideal for underpinning existing structures or working in tight spaces.
auger cast piles - created by drilling and filling with concrete for reliable load-bearing capacity.
sheet piling - used to retain soil during excavation or construction projects.

Deep Foundation Installation Questions
What is deep foundation installation? It involves placing strong support structures beneath a building to ensure stability on challenging soil conditions.
When is deep foundation installation needed? It is typically required for large structures, uneven terrain, or areas with poor soil support to prevent settling or shifting.
What types of projects require deep foundations? Common projects include commercial buildings, residential basements, retaining walls, and other structures that need enhanced stability.
How does the process impact property development? Proper installation provides a solid base, reducing the risk of foundation issues and supporting long-term structural integrity.
